Learn how to write poetry with 12 proven poetry writing tips from former US Poet Laureate Ted Kooser as Nathan Hassall, Poet Laureate of Malibu, breaks down "The Poetry Home Repair Manual" into 25 minutes of actionable writing tips for beginner poets.
